GTA VI's Unprecedented Budget

Rockstar Games has not publicly disclosed the budget for Grand Theft Auto VI, but analysts estimate it to be well over $1 billion, with some figures suggesting it could reach $1.5 billion. This places GTA VI as potentially the most expensive entertainment product ever created, surpassing both major film productions and other high-budget video games.

Factors Driving High Development Costs

The substantial budget for GTA VI is attributed to the complexity of modern game development. Creating an expansive open-world game requires large teams of actors, writers, programmers, animators, designers, and composers. Unlike many films with multi-year production schedules, GTA VI has been in active development for nearly a decade, further contributing to its escalating costs.

Comparison to Other Major Titles

While a billion-dollar game budget might seem surprising, game development costs have been steadily rising. For instance, court documents revealed that Sony Interactive Entertainment spent $212 million on Horizon Forbidden West and $220 million on The Last of Us: Part II. More recently, Activision's development costs for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War exceeded $700 million over its lifecycle, demonstrating the trend of increasing expenditures in the industry.
